Paul C. LaMarre III
Manager of Maritime Affairs

Paul C. LaMarre III is the Manager of Maritime Affairs. His responsibilities include direct operational support of the president as well as all managerial aspects of “Toledo’s Flagship,” the S.S. Willis B. Boyer.

Mr. LaMarre joined the Port Authority staff June 1, 2007 following his employment by the City of Toledo as operator of the S.S. Willis B. Boyer. Prior to that, he served as a deck officer on multiple Great Lakes towing vessels.

A graduate of the California Maritime Academy, Mr. LaMarre holds a bachelor of science degree in Marine Transportation with minors in logistics and naval science, as well as his USCG License 3rd Mates License for unlimited tonnage vessels. He has also served as pilot in the United States Navy, having logged the majority of his flight hours in the F/A-18 Hornet, and remains a Lieutenant in the naval reserve.

Mr. LaMarre is an active member of the International Shipmasters’ Association, a board member of the Marine Historical Society of Detroit, as well as a member of the Great Lakes Historical Society, Steamship Historical Society of America, and Tailhook Association. He and his wife Rebecca reside in Milan, Michigan.
